What's the most important thing for you if you started to buy things online with bitcoin?
Privacy and a smooth interface. Lightning would be a bonus.

Make sure you generate a new address for each customer for each transaction. I would not be happy using a service which only gives me a single address to pay to.

I've ran in to problems with some services who calculate prices in fiat, and give a price in bitcoin. Most will give a window of something like 15-30 minutes for the transaction to be made, and after that the transaction will be cancelled to protect from price changes. However, there was one I used in the past which wanted the transaction to be confirmed, not just broadcast, within the 15 minute window. Even with a high fee, sometimes that is impossible if there is a longer delay to the next block being found. It was then a total hassle to get them to credit my transaction against a future purchase.

I really like your idea of having your balance within the platform.
In that case, maybe take a look at how Bitrefill works. You can pay the exact amount required when you place an order, but you can also deposit BTC to your account, and then pay from your account balance instantly when placing an order. Sometimes when I use it, to save on generating small change outputs, I'll transfer a whole UTXO to my account and then buy what I need, leaving the extra few bucks in my account. As much as I don't like ever leaving my funds on third party sites, it's only ever a small amount so I don't worry about it, and I'll always spend it in the not too distant future.
